May Monthly Maintenance Tips

Here are few tips for the month of May as things heat up:

Plant the following veggies: Cantaloupe, cucumber, New Zealand spinach, Malabar spinach, peppers, summer squash, tomatillo EARLY MAY: Chard, eggplant, okra, sweet potato slips LATE MAY: Watermelon

Make an Herb Spiral and plants some herbs: basil, bay, catnip, chives, comfrey, epazote, lamb's ear, lavender, lemon balm, lemon verbena, Mexican mint marigold, mints, oregano, pennyroyal, rosemary, sage, winter savory, tansy, thyme, yarrow

Plants some annuals, especially Nasturtrium and Marigolds to deter pest from you veg gardens: celosia, cleome, coreopsis, cosmos, four o'clock, gomphrena (globe amaranth), gourd, marigold, moonflower, morning glory, scaevola (fan flower), sunflower, zinnia


Watering Guide:
It is better to water established plants deeper and less often, rather than shallowly and frequently. The exception is newly seeded areas and your veggies, which may need daily watering. Water only as needed; turn off automatic sprinkler systems when we get good rainfall.

MULCH! Make sure to mulch all your exposed beds so there is no exposed dirt!

MOW! Continue to mow your lawn to keep the roots strong and healthy. On average you can mow every 10 days.
